Super Bowl 2025 Events in New Orleans

Super Bowl 2025 festivities New Orleans

As Super Bowl LIX approaches on February 9, 2025, New Orleans is abuzz with a series of events leading up to the highly anticipated game between the Kansas City Chiefs and the Philadelphia Eagles. The city, renowned for its vibrant culture and festive spirit, has curated a lineup of activities to engage both locals and visitors.

Kendrick Lamar to Headline Halftime Show

The Super Bowl LIX halftime show will be headlined by acclaimed hip-hop artist Kendrick Lamar. Known for his dynamic performances and thought-provoking lyrics, Lamar is expected to deliver a memorable show that resonates with a wide audience.

Special Guest Appearance by SZA

Joining Kendrick Lamar during the halftime performance is Grammy-winning R&B artist SZA. The two have previously collaborated on hits like “All the Stars,” and their reunion on stage is highly anticipated by fans.

National Anthem by Jon Batiste

Grammy-winning musician Jon Batiste is slated to perform the national anthem, bringing his soulful rendition to the Super Bowl audience. A New Orleans native, Batiste’s involvement adds a local touch to the national event.

Pre-Game Performances by Local Artists

In addition to the main acts, the Super Bowl will feature pre-game performances by local talents, including jazz musician Trombone Shorty and R&B vocalist Ledisi. These artists will showcase the rich musical heritage of New Orleans, setting the tone for the game.

Super Bowl Experience at Woldenberg Park

From February 7 to 8, Woldenberg Park on the Riverfront hosts the Super Bowl Experience, offering interactive games, player meet-and-greets, and live entertainment. This family-friendly event allows fans to engage with the sport beyond the stadium.
